However, "associatedStreet" is maybe not the most obvious choice for
joining, say, the segments of a motorway; at least I thought,
"associatedStreet" would be used for associating single ways (street
segments) with waypoints (symbolising addresses along the street
segment) only. In addition (being, however, no native speaker of
English), using "associatedStreet" for a collection of ways sounds
strange to me.

> True, it's not two but three relations proposals for the same purpose:
> "collection", "street" and "associatedStreet"
>
> Although"collection" is not limited to streets, it's also proposing
> street addresses members...
>
>
> Since "associatedStreet" was historicaly the first proposal including
> house numbers and is the most popular according to Tagwatch, I would
> suggest to deprecate the "street" proposal and remove streets from the
> "collection" proposal.
